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lympstone Village to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) start from as little as £78.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lympstone Village to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) start from £190.60 one way, or £272.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lympstone Village to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) are available for £199.00 one way, or £398.00 return

Everything you need to know about Lympstone Village Station

Discover Lympstone Village Train Station

Welcome to Lympstone Village, a quaint train station that serves the picturesque South Devon town of Lympstone. This station, part of the Avocet Line, offers travelers a remarkable charm with a rustic atmosphere, synonymous with many rural UK train stations. Ideal for those who appreciate a quieter, less congested travel option, Lympstone Village stands out as a peaceful gateway to numerous adventures along the Southwest coast and beyond. Whether you're a commuter, a casual traveler, or a curious explorer, this station maintains a sense of simplicity and calm while connecting you to your destinations.

Facilities and Amenities

Lympstone Village may not boast a plethora of high-tech facilities, but it provides the essentials for a comfortable journey. Although there is no ticket office, tickets can be purchased online before arrival. For those who rely on digital solutions, it's worth noting that there are no ticket machines available. Walking through the station, you'll find that it provides step-free access to some parts, which is helpful for travelers with mobility concerns.

The station doesn’t have lounges or waiting rooms but does offer seating areas where you can rest while waiting for your train. For anyone requiring assistance, the station has a help point that provides vital information, ensuring you're supported during your journey. In terms of safety and security, there is no CCTV on site, so it’s prudent to remain vigilant with your belongings.

Onward Travel From Lympstone Village

If you're planning to explore further afield, Lympstone Village station is your springboard to numerous locations. Though there is no direct taxi service at the station, you can plan your journey with local bus links for onward travel. Be sure to check the onward travel poster for complete bus service details and other transport connections. If you've ever wondered about bike hire, the station doesn't have services onsite, but bike stands are available for those who cycle to the station.

Everything you need to know about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) Station

All Aboard at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) Station

Welcome to the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) station—a bustling hub of activity set amid the nuance of Scottish culture. Whether you’re a tourist eager to explore Glasgow’s vibrant city life or a daily commuter heading to work, this station offers a wealth of amenities designed with your convenience in mind.

Amenities and Facilities

At Exhibition Centre (Glasgow), starting your journey is a breeze. The station’s ticket office is open from early morning until late at night, making it convenient for you to purchase or collect your tickets during the week and on weekends. Don’t have time to stand in line? No worries! There are ticket machines available so you can swiftly grab your fare and be on your way. Plus, these machines are accessible, ensuring that everyone can use them with ease.

For those keen on travelling smart, the station supports smartcards, though it does not issue them on-site. Fear not; validators are provided for a quick and tech-savvy entry and exit. And if you have any questions or require assistance, there's a friendly staff presence, ready to help you from their post at the help point or ticket office.

Transport Options at Your Service

The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) station is well-connected to several transport options, ensuring you can reach your final destination without hassle. For bus services, simply head over to Minerva Street where buses pick up and drop off passengers. You can check the exact stop through the handy ///what3words location service. If you prefer to travel by taxi, a quick visit to TrainTaxi will provide full details of available taxi services. And for all the latest on local bus routes and timings, Travel Line Scotland stands ready as your comprehensive guide.
